As our Logistics Coordinator, you will be the pulse of the Bristol transport hub, balancing meticulous data management with real‑time problem solving. Working closely with the Group Transport Manager, you will ensure our drivers are supported and our compliance standards remain industry‑leading.
- Planning & Dispatch: Produce daily and weekly transport plans, assign routes to drivers, and manage all shift paperwork to ensure a seamless start and end to the day.
- Fleet & Compliance: Maintain rigorous compliance records, download vehicle tachographs, and manage the fleet schedule by coordinating with service providers for maintenance and collections.
- Operational Support: Oversee deliveries proactively, act as the primary point of contact for permanent and agency drivers, and resolve route issues to keep the depot fully informed.
- Administration & Finance: Handle essential data entry via the Accord system, record KPIs and vehicle weights, and manage the weekly release of forward orders and daily invoicing.
We are looking for an ambitious individual who is eager to learn and progress within the business, bringing a blend of transport knowledge and administrative precision.
Experience: You should possess foundational knowledge of transport or planning within the logistics industry and be comfortable working in a fast‑paced, small‑team environment.
Hard Skills: Proficient in data entry and record‑keeping (ideally with systems like Accord), you have a sharp eye for accuracy regarding vehicle weights, KPIs, and compliance documentation.
Soft Skills: A proactive communicator who can build trust with drivers and customers alike, you remain calm under pressure when solving route problems and are always willing to help cover other sites when needed.
